Dimensiona o TC de proteção (IEC 61869-2 / NBR 6856): menor primário comercial que NÃO satura na falta, considerando o burden REAL (relé+fiação) e o ALF efetivo. `xr` (X/R) = liga o critério de saturação na falta ASSIMÉTRICA (offset CC, IEEE C37.110): um TC que passa no simétrico pode saturar no transitório, atrasar o relé e ELEVAR a energia incidente de arco. `I_load_A`+`Fter` = corrente de carga p/ o critério térmico contínuo. `Ith_A`/`Idyn_A` = corrente térmica (I²t, com `t_curto_s`/`tth_s`) e dinâmica de catálogo → robustez à falta passante (se o TC AGUENTA o curto sem dano térmico/mecânico). `Rct_ohm` = R do secundário de catálogo (None → estimada).
